Pei: OnePlus First Year Did $300M Total, Profitable Only Internationally
“After one year, after launching the product at OnePlus, China did one hundred million dollars in revenue. International did two hundred million. China lost money. International made money.”

Pei: US tariffs on China hit Nothing's earbud business by 20%
“So now the most direct way is Trump had new tariffs for manufacturing from China. So we manufacture the earbuds in China. And that's like a 20% hit on our import business plans for the US market.”

Pei: Global smartphone market is 1.2B units annually worth over $300B
“Smartphones globally is about 1.2 billion units every year. In India, it's one 20 to one forty million annually, depending on what number you look at. So if you assume that the ASP is 300 dollars, then 1.2 billion, that's over three hundred billion dollars, ju…”
